Game Recap
The Oklahoma State Cowboys triumphed over the Houston Cougars with a final score of 43-30. The game began with a thrilling interception return for a touchdown by Houston's Isaiah Hamilton, setting an early tone for the matchup. Oklahoma State came back strong, particularly in the second half, with Ollie Gordon II scoring multiple rushing touchdowns that shifted the momentum in their favor.
Despite a strong start by Houston, Oklahoma State's balanced offensive attack proved too much to handle. Quarterback Alan Bowman threw for 348 yards and two touchdowns, while Gordon II's three rushing touchdowns sealed the victory. Houston's efforts were highlighted by Donovan Smith's multi-dimensional role with both passing and rushing touchdowns, but it wasn't enough to overcome Oklahoma State's offensive prowess.

Standout Players:
Alan Bowman (Oklahoma State Cowboys, QB)
Completed 29 of 43 passes for 348 yards, 2 touchdowns, and 1 interceptionOllie Gordon II (Oklahoma State Cowboys, RB)
Rushed 25 times for 164 yards and 3 touchdowns, including key scores in the second halfIsaiah Hamilton (Houston Cougars, DB)
Returned an interception for a 57-yard touchdown, sparking early momentum for HoustonDonovan Smith (Houston Cougars, QB)
Multi-talented performance with 235 passing yards, 1 passing TD, 63 rushing yards, 1 rushing TD, and a 28-yard receiving touchdownBrennan Presley (Oklahoma State Cowboys, WR)
Caught 15 passes for 189 yards, consistently moving the chains for Oklahoma State
